Can you eat raw pumpkin?
Raw pumpkin has a hearty, rich flavor that makes it a good stand-alone snack or side dish. One of the best ways to eat pumpkin is to slice it into cubes, but you can also eat raw canned pumpkin.
Can you boil pumpkin with skin on?
One of the secrets to cooking pumpkin is choosing a small pie pumpkin. ... Another secret to cooking pumpkin is cooking it with the skin still on, because the tough skin is much easier to remove when the flesh has been cooked. There are many ways to cook pumpkin, including baking, slow cooking, microwaving, and steaming.
Can you eat pumpkin out of a can without cooking it?
A: Yes, it's cooked. It's been steamed and pureed. It's safe to eat right from the can, but we think it tastes better in a pumpkin cheesecake.
Is undercooked pumpkin pie safe to eat?
Is it safe to eat undercooked pumpkin pie? No. Undercooked pumpkin pie contains raw eggs and can make you sick. ... When in doubt, bake the pie a little longer rather then risk an under-baked pie.
Why won't my pumpkin pie cook in the middle?
If your pumpkin pie is set on the edge, yet the center is still just a bit jiggly, then you have cooked your pie to perfection. If there is a best pumpkin pie contest you can enter into, you might want to start clearing off your trophy case. As your pie cools, the center will firm up.
Do I need to refrigerate pumpkin pie?
Pumpkin pie is made with eggs and milk; it must first be safely baked to a safe minimum internal temperature of 160 degrees Fahrenheit. Other pies made with milk and eggs such as custard pie or cheese cake should be treated similarly. Then, they must be refrigerated after baking.

Can pumpkin pie sit out overnight?
According to the FDA, homemade pumpkin pie can be left at room temperature for two hours, after which it is in danger of growing harmful bacteria. Homemade pumpkin pie is safe in the fridge for 2 to 4 days, so it's best to store it there after it cools.
What is the best way to reheat a pie?
Place pies on a baking tray and cover with foil, this stops the pie tops from burning. Place in the oven for 20 minutes. Remove the foil and return to the oven for around 5 minutes ensuring the pies are piping hot. Allow the pie to stand for 2-3 minutes before serving.
How long does it take to reheat a pie in the oven?
Heating Fully Baked Pies: Pre-heat your oven to 350 degrees. Put the pie, turnovers, or pastry on a cookie sheet on foil or parchment, and lightly cover with foil. For a 9-inch pie, heat for 15-20 minutes. A 5-inch pie will take about 12-15 minutes and turnovers will take about 10-12 minutes.
